Output 63866a98cb53d78060aaf2959cb685f360ca33cc40cfd949801058e59a96a31e:1

value
12229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f5d43b356df6b2560a063bec673275daa99fbb4 OP_EQUAL
address
37U4DkrtPkzUTsbns9W36GS9NRFoXvg64P
transaction
63866a98cb53d78060aaf2959cb685f360ca33cc40cfd949801058e59a96a31e
spent
true